LOW SKEW, 1-TO-5, DIFFERENTIAL-TO-
2.5V, 3.3V LVPECL/ECL FANOUT BUFFER
ICS853014
Features
Five differential LVPECL/ECL outputs
Two selectable differential LVPECL clock inputs
PCLKx, nPCLKx pairs can accept the following
differential input levels: LVPECL, LVDS, CML, SSTL
Maximum output frequency: > 2GHz
Output skew: 13ps (typical)
Part-to-part skew: 60ps (typical)
Propagation delay: 460ps (typical)

General Description
ICS
HiPerClockS™
The ICS853014 is a low skew, high performance
1-to-5, 2.5V/3.3V Differential-to-LVPECL/ECL
Fanout Buffer and a member of the HiPerClockS™
family of High Performance Clock Solutions from
IDT. The ICS853014 has two selectable clock
inputs.
Guaranteed output and part-to-part skew characteristics make the
ICS853014 ideal for those applications demanding well defined
performance and repeatability.
